Realized early yest morning that the best layed plans have no bearing on mother natures course, lol.

Night before last (tues) we had one heckuva time getting fancy in the barn....she was wired for sound..we chalked it up to there mustve been deer down back, or something....something definately had her on guard. After about 2 hours, we were able to get her stalled and let her out again after she tried coming through the stall door. Anyway, on one of the coldest nights of the year, we left the barn door open so she could come in when she wanted to. Tina, nonchalant as always was tucked in for the night. Bill went out about 1030 to check on them, Fancy was still posed and stressed, Tina was happily munching on hay.
Anyway, about 630 weds morning, i looked out the window and saw them both outside....my fears were put to rest that something was waiting in the wings....ha little did i know, lol.
About 730 rob got up and looked out the window and yelled at me....."Hey Jen, when did we get a 3rd horse"........huh whuttttttttt?????
Yup, fancy mustve playing watch dog while Tina foaled....3 1/2 weeks early!
So, I give you Katy....shes perfect in every way : )
